U3O8 Corp. (TSX VENTURE:UWE), a Canadian-based company focused on exploration and resource expansion of uranium and associated commodities in South America, reports on its Berlin Project in Colombia that:

--  assays from an additional five bore holes drilled in the infill program
    completed in the southern part of the project further confirm excellent
    continuity of uranium and multi-commodity mineralization; 
    
    
--  positive, initial metallurgical test results are being corroborated for
    anticipated release in December, 2011; and 
    
    
--  work is progressing well towards the completion, by year-end, of the
    first National Instrument 43-101 ("NI 43-101") resource estimate
    undertaken on the property since the historic 38 million pound ("mlb")
    uranium resource(1) was calculated in 1981.
    
    

(1) The Berlin historic resource of 12.9 million tonnes at an average grade of 0.13% U3O8 (38mlb U3O8) is reported in Castano, R. (1981), Calcul provisoire des reserves geologiques de Berlin, sur la base des resultants des sondages, Unpublished Minatome report, 15p. As the 38mlb U3O8 historic estimate is based on only 11 widely-spaced drill holes, 20 trenches and three adits, it should not be considered a NI 43-101 compliant resource. The historic resource is regarded by U3O8 Corp. as merely an indication of the uranium resource potential of the southern 4.4 kilometres ("km") of a 10.5km long syncline (Figure 1) containing the Berlin mineralization. The historic resource did not include estimates for other commodities. U3O8 Corp. has now completed an infill drilling program with the aim of defining an interim multi-commodity mineral resource on the southernmost 3km of the Berlin trend.

U3O8 Corp. has now completed the planned exploration and infill drilling program of 82 bore holes (18,685 metres) that was designed to provide sufficient detail for an initial NI 43-101 resource estimate to be undertaken on the southern 3km of the Berlin Project. Assays from the 63 drill holes disclosed so far confirm excellent continuity of mineralization in the fertile layer at Berlin. Results from six trenches in the northern part of the 10.5km mineralized trend highlight the potential of the Berlin Project to contain a resource substantially in excess of the historic resource.

The mineralized layer in the Berlin Project occurs as a canoe-shaped fold that, in cross-section, has an asymmetric "U"-shape (Figure 3). In order to visualize the distribution of mineralization, Figure 4 shows the layer as an "unfolded", flat sheet and also marks the bore hole intercepts from which samples are currently undergoing metallurgical testing.
